Tantalum Ring

Updated: 2026-08-03

Overview

Tantalum rings are precision-engineered components fabricated from tantalum, a refractory metal renowned for its durability in harsh conditions. These rings are commonly utilized in industries where resistance to acids, high temperatures, or ultra-high vacuum is essential. Their non-reactive nature makes them ideal for medical implants and chemical reactors alike. Manufacturing processes include powder metallurgy or machining from wrought tantalum, ensuring tight tolerances (often ±0.05mm). Grades like R05200 (UNS) are prevalent, with some applications requiring oxide-free surfaces for optimal performance in semiconductor fabrication.

Structure and Working Principle

Tantalum rings are typically annular with standardized inner/outer diameters and thicknesses. Their functionality relies on tantalum's innate properties: a dense oxide layer forms upon exposure to air, providing passive corrosion protection even against aqua regia or hot hydrochloric acid. In vacuum systems, these rings act as diffusion barriers or thermal shields due to low outgassing rates. In electrochemical applications, their conductivity and stability enable use as anode holders in electrolytic capacitors. The metal's ductility allows for custom shapes like flanged or grooved designs to enhance sealing efficiency.

Key Features

Corrosion resistance is unparalleled, outperforming even platinum in acidic environments. Tantalum's melting point (3,017°C) ranks among the highest of all metals, making these rings suitable for furnace linings or molten metal handling. Biocompatibility permits use in surgical implants, while low thermal expansion minimizes stress in temperature-cycling applications. Electrical resistivity (131 nΩ·m at 20°C) and thermal conductivity (57.5 W/m·K) balance performance in electronic components. Surface finishes range from mill to mirror polish, with roughness (Ra) as low as 0.4μm for critical sealing surfaces.

Application Areas

Chemical processing: Lining reaction vessels, pump seals for sulfuric/nitric acid production. Semiconductor: Plasma etching components, wafer carriers. Aerospace: Rocket nozzle insulation rings. Medical: Bone repair mesh retainers, MRI-compatible housings. Energy: Sputtering targets for thin-film solar cells. Glass manufacturing: Molten tin bath components. Their use extends to cryogenics, where tantalum retains ductility at temperatures as low as -196°C, preventing brittle fracture in liquid nitrogen applications.

Maintenance and Precautions

Avoid galling during assembly by using tantalum-compatible lubricants like molybdenum disulfide. Clean with ethanol or acetone—never hydrofluoric acid, which dissolves the oxide layer. Store in inert atmospheres if long-term oxide layer consistency is critical. In high-temperature cycles (>300°C), account for slight oxidation darkening, which doesn't compromise performance. For welded assemblies, use electron beam welding under vacuum to prevent embrittlement. Regular inspections should check for mechanical deformation in load-bearing applications.

B2B Procurement Guide

Specify ASTM B365 or AMS 7848 standards when ordering. Bulk purchases (50+ units) typically yield 15–30% cost reductions. Lead times vary from 2 weeks (standard sizes) to 8 weeks (custom geometries). Certifications to request: Material test reports (MTRs) with traceable lot numbers, RoHS compliance documentation, and ISO 9001/AS9100 for aerospace use. For corrosive service, insist on ASTM G31 immersion testing data. Distributors specializing in refractory metals often provide technical support for application-specific design optimizations.
